DNS解析过程分析如何快速解决DNS错误

时间:2025-12-15 分类:网络技术

DNS(域名系统)是互联网中不可或缺的一部分,它将人们易于记忆的域名转换成计算机能够理解的IP地址。在这个过程中,任何错误都可能导致网站访问障碍,影响用户体验。了解DNS解析的基本流程,以及如何快速定位和解决DNS相关问题,变得尤为重要。本文将深入探讨DNS解析过程,并提供一些有效的解决方案,帮助用户快速应对DNS错误。

DNS解析过程分析如何快速解决DNS错误

了解DNS解析的基本流程是必要的。当用户在浏览器中输入域名时,系统首先查询本地DNS缓存。如果缓存中不存在相应的记录,系统将向本地DNS服务器发送请求。如果本地服务器不能解析该域名,它会将请求转发到根DNS服务器,后者再根据请求的信息指引到对应的顶级域名服务器,最终到达权威DNS服务器,获取所需的IP地址并返回给用户。这个过程通常在几毫秒内完成,一旦任一步骤出现错误,用户将无法访问目标网站。

在实际应用中,DNS错误的类型繁多,例如DNS解析失败、无法找到服务器等。针对这些问题,用户可以通过几种方式进行排查。检查网络连接是否正常是最基本的步骤。无论是无线网络还是有线网络,网络不通都会导致DNS解析失败。接下来,可以尝试使用不同的DNS服务器,例如Google的8.8.8.8或者Cloudflare的1.1.1.1,这两者通常提供稳定且快速的解析服务。

还有一个常见的方法是清理DNS缓存。过时或损坏的缓存记录可能导致解析错误。在Windows系统中,可以通过命令行输入ipconfig /flushdns来清理缓存,而在MacOS系统中,使用sudo killall -HUP mDNSResponder命令即可。重新启动路由器也是解决DNS问题的有效手段之一,它可以重置网络连接,并更新DNS服务器信息。

如果用户仍然遇到持续的DNS问题,可以通过使用在线工具进行诊断。例如,DNS Checker等工具可以帮助检测DNS设置是否正确,排除任何配置错误。了解域名是否到期或域名服务器是否正常工作,都是解决DNS问题的关键因素。及时与注册商联系,确认域名状态和DNS设置,可以有效避免因错误配置导致的访问问题。

最终,稳定的互联网体验离不开健康的DNS解析。通过了解DNS解析的工作机制,及时进行问题排查和处理,用户不仅能够快速解决DNS错误,还能在数字时代中更顺畅地浏览各类网站。希望借助以上分析和建议,用户能够进一步提升网络使用体验,减少因DNS错误带来的困扰。